The Senior Accountant plays a pivotal role in the finance department, responsible for ensuring the accuracy and integrity of financial records. This position involves complex accounting tasks, financial analysis, and a degree of mentor-ship for junior accounting staff. The Senior Accountant will contribute to the month-end and year-end closing processes, assist with audits, and ensure compliance with accounting standards.

Key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Financial Reporting and Analysis: 

    • Prepare and analyze financial statements,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ements.   

    • Conduct variance analysis and provide insights into financial performance.   

    • Assist with the preparation of financial reports for internal and external stakeholders.

    • Ensure compliance with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P) or International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S).

    •  Checks/verifies all payment before approval

    •   Ensures that all statements, documents and bank balances from branches have been received regularly.

    • Checks payments and other expenditures that they are consistent with the approved financial procedures of the company.

    • Checks/verifies payrolls of the staff and makes sure that it is paid and all necessary government taxes are deducted and paid on time

    • Checks accuracy of all transactions posted to the accounting system of the organization.

  • General Ledger and Account Reconciliation: 

    • Maintain and reconcile general ledger accounts.

    • Prepare and post journal entries.

    • Perform complex account reconciliations and resolve discrepancies.

  • Month-End and Year-End Close: 

    • Participate in the month-end and year-end closing processes, ensuring timely and accurate completion.

    • Prepare and review closing journal entries.

    • Assist with the preparation of audit schedules.

  • Audit and Compliance: 

    • Assist with internal and external audits by providing necessary documentation and support.

    • Ensure compliance with financial regulations and internal control procedures.

    • Assist with the preparation of tax returns.

  • Team Leadership and Mentorship: 

    • Provide guidance and support to junior accounting staff.

    • Review the work of junior accountants for accuracy and completeness.

    • Assist in the training and development of accounting staff.

  • Process Improvement: 

    • Identify and recommend improvements to accounting processes and procedures.

    • Assist in the implementation of new accounting systems and software.
